  1. Better SEO Rankings with Mobile-First Design

 

Google has transitioned to mobile-first indexing, meaning that the mobile version of your website is considered the primary version for ranking on search engine results pages (SERPs). Websites that offer a poor mobile experience will likely rank lower, regardless of how well the desktop version is optimized. This shift makes it imperative for Dutch businesses to prioritize mobile-first design if they want to stay visible in search results.

 

Mobile-first websites often load faster, are more user-friendly, and provide better navigation—all of which are critical ranking factors in Google’s algorithm.   1. Faster Load Times on Mobile Devices

 

Speed is everything when it comes to websites, especially on mobile devices. Studies show that if a page takes more than three seconds to load, 53% of users will abandon it. In a fast-paced business environment like the Netherlands, where customers expect immediate access to information, having a website that loads slowly on mobile devices is a major disadvantage.

 

Mobile-first design prioritizes the essentials and eliminates unnecessary elements that could slow down load times.
